# Service Accounts — ConsentGate Rollout

The ConsentGate banner rollout uses two service accounts. `cg-deploy` pushes banner bundles to edge nodes; `cg-audit` writes opt-in records to the Ledgewick store. Both are scoped read-write to their own namespaces only. Never grant `cg-deploy` audit access — past incident, see postmortem P-77. Rotation is quarterly, owned by whoever maintains this page. Tokens live in the Hollis vault under the consent namespace. For local testing against staging, use the key that follows.

app token of bahaf-tajeg = zpat23_SjjsllwiLmXbtS65veZaV47

Ticket: Staging env misconfigured for Siftgate bloom filter

The bloom layer in front of the Pellet KV store is rejecting all lookups in staging because the env file was copied from the dev template without credentials. False-positive tuning values are fine; only the auth line is missing. To unblock the weekly demo, the Pellet admission secret must be set on the following line.

env line for yaguf-fajop: LEDGER_TOKEN13=fb08984397349

Day-to-day operations continue unchanged until the transfer completes. Affected staff will receive transition packages, and customer accounts tied to the unit will migrate under existing terms. Branch managers should direct all inquiries to the transition office rather than commenting locally. A customer-facing statement will follow once regulatory review concludes. The confidential rationale for the sale is summarized below.

board note of tawip-hahip: Only 7 of the 80 pilot accounts renewed Ralath, so a churn review is set for April 1.